Witryna7 sty 2024 · This purchase was not Kimura’s first time paying millions for a fish. At the Toyosu fish market 2024 auction celebrating the new year, Kimura purchased a bluefin tuna weighing in at 612 pounds for over $3 million, paying an extra $1.2 million for 4 more pounds of fish. Kyoto. 💵 Cost of living for ex-pat:$1.930/ month. 1bedroom studio rent in the center: $625/ month. Hotel: $65/ night. Dinner: $6.36. Coffee: $3.86. Kyoto is a top tourist destination that no traveler wants to miss and also considered as one of the cheapest places to live in Japan.
